Index of /upload/product/57897

 NameLast modifiedSizeDescription

 Parent Directory   -  
 mouse-sata-a-gm08-rg..>2023-11-10 09:07 50K 
 m-mouse-sata-a-gm08-..>2023-11-10 09:07 12K